From a disc of radius R, a concentric circular portion of radius r is cut-out so as to leave an annular disc of mass M. The moment of inertial of this annular disc about the axis perpendicular to its plane and passing through its centre of gravity is

Options

(a) M/2(R²+r²)
(b) M/2(R²-r²)
(c) M/2(R⁴+r⁴)
(d) M/2(R⁴-r⁴)

Correct Answer:

M/2(R²+r²)
